Anderson 'wants to make film in space'
Published Sunday, Nov 1 2009, 08:50 GMT | By Catriona Wightman

The Fantastic Mr Fox director told Access Hollywood that he would love to make a sci-fi film.
"I'd like to do a movie in space," he said. "If possible, I would like to try to actually shoot some of it on location in space. That's my preference."
Anderson explained that he is not planning to make a sci-fi film soon, but said that he wants his next movie to be based on one of his own ideas.
"I have an idea for something that's just my own," he said. "But I would like to do more adaptations. It's nice to reach a point in the story and say, 'What happens in the book?' and you can just look in that and get your answer."
